パイプラインコマンドへの入力の追加

パイプラインコマンドへの入力の追加

エイリアスにパイプされたコマンドを使用してDockerサーバーを起動します(例alias ent="echo -e '\n';docker-compose up|grep --color ERROR":)。

サーバーで時々入力する必要がある質問を私に尋ねるかもしれませyn。私はいつもy

パイプラインコマンドにこれを追加するにはどうすればよいですか?

ベストアンサー1

yes指揮者にぴったりの職業だと思います!

マンページから:

説明
指定されたすべての文字列または「y」を含む行の出力を繰り返します。

これは単純なyes出力が無限であることを意味しますy

これにはdocker-compose up「is」入力が必要なので、次のようなものを使用できます。

alias ent="echo -e '\n';yes | docker-compose up | grep --color ERROR"

おすすめ記事